What is the proper method for using a walker during ambulation?

The proper method for using a walker during ambulation involves setting it down and walking to it. This technique ensures stability and safety for the user. When the walker is placed in front of the individual, they can use it as a support structure to maintain balance and alignment while walking. The individual should step into the walker each time rather than pulling it closer, which can lead to loss of balance and increased risk of falls.

Using the walker in this way allows the person to maintain proper posture and gait mechanics, enabling smoother and safer movement. Proper use is essential for maximizing the walker’s benefits, which include providing adequate support and reducing the risk of injury during ambulation.
